Learners in Niles New Tech Entrepreneurial Academy spent a good portion of April creating videos intended to inform citizens on the role of the United States in World War II, while honoring those who lost their lives for our freedom.

Learners got into groups of four to complete the project.

Leader Publications will be providing links to the top videos in the coming days.

May 8 and 9 are nationally honored as the time of remembrance and reconciliation for those that lost their lives during the Second World War.

This video was created by Jessica Akey, Chris Prenkert, Mika Farinella and Bradley Holland.

Here is what they said about their video:

“As learners at Niles New Tech, we sought to honor soldiers who fought in World War II.  In our video we depict Axis Aggression through the Nazi Invasion of Poland.”
